Interview advice
Going for the Software Engineer role at LearniLMWorld? A few things that help freshers walk in prepared:
- Revise core data structures and be ready to explain the logic in your best project line by line โ interviewers care more about how you reason than which language you used.
- Spend 30 to 60 minutes beforehand on the company's site, recent news and LinkedIn, so you can name one specific reason you want to join when they ask.
- Re-read the job description and prepare two projects or coursework examples that map directly to what it asks for.
- Rehearse "tell me about yourself" out loud in about 60 seconds โ education, one standout achievement, why this role โ instead of reciting your CV top to bottom.
- Put numbers on your achievements: "8.5/10 GPA", "cut load time by 40%", "led a team of four" lands far better than "good grades" or "hard-working".
